New changelog entries:
* Repack gosa src:package in order to drop several subtrees of the source
code:
- Smarty3 sources,
- Smarty Gettext sources,
- Liberation font, further fonts shipped with pChart,
- Scriptaculous.js,
- and upstream's debian/ packaging folder.
* debian/README.multi-orig-tarball-package:
+ Grammar fix.
* debian/gosa.postinst:
+ When activating gosa for lighttpd, create /etc/lighttpd/conf-enabled/
if it does not exist, yet. (Closes: #757558).
* debian/control:
+ Make sure that all GOsa² component/plugin bin:packages match the exact
version of the gosa bin:package.
+ Add D (gosa): smarty-gettext.
+ Add D (gosa): libjs-scriptaculous.
* debian/rules:
+ Rework get-orig-source rule, remove embedded libraries from upstream
source tree.
+ Stop shipping fonts with gosa src:package in Debian (via
get-orig-source).
+ Use Debian's version of smarty-gettext (via symlink).
+ Use Debian's version of Scriptaculous.js and Prototype.js (via symlinks).
+ Improve readability. Add some comments.
* debian/copyright:
+ Update file.
+ Update debian/copyright.in template.
* lintian:
+ Drop override embedded-php-library for Smarty3. Not shipped in repacked
sources anymore.
+ Drop override embedded-php-library for Scriptaculous.js and Prototype.js.
Not shipped in repacked sources anymore.
+ Drop unused overrides.
* debian/patches:
+ Add 1004_fix-typos-in-man-pages.patch. Fix several typos and
hyphen-used-as-minus-sign issues in GOsa² man pages.
+ Update 0001_smarty3.patch. The sources of smarty-gettext are not shipped
with Debian's gosa src:package anymore.
+ Improve trimming in 1002_trim-decrypt.patch. Obtained from latest password
encryption/decryption tests with FusionDirectory.
+ Provide patch headers with Author: and Description: fields whereever
possible.
New changelog entries:
* debian/patches:
+ Add 0004_RequestHeader-no-underscores-apache24.patch. Since Apache2.4:
Translation of headers to environment variables is more strict than before
to mitigate some possible cross-site-scripting attacks via header
injection. Headers containing invalid characters (including underscores)
are now silently dropped. (Closes: #753419).
New changelog entries:
* debian/control:
+ Update Vcs-*: fields. Packaging has been moved to Alioth and is now
Git based.
+ Bump Standards: to 3.9.5. Fixed DEP-5 compliancy of debian/copyright.
* debian/copyright:
+ Make file DEP-5 compliant.
+ Add CDBS-autogenerated debian/copyright.in file for later reference.
* debian/gosa.prerm:
+ Ignore those valid prerm options that nothing has to be done for.
(Closes: #745045).
* debian/gosa.postrm:
+ Handle apache2 config symlink removal and Apache2 restarts properly
on package purging. (Closes: #744151).
* debian/gosa.postinst:
+ Only create Apache2.2 symlinks if Apache2.4 conf-available folder is
not present.
* Remove obsolete packaging files for formerly embedded bin:package smarty3.
* package scripts: Whitespace clean-up. Use tabs as indentations.